Abstract

ABSTRACT POLITENESS STRATEGY USED BY THE SPEAKERS IN DISCUSSION DISTANCE LEARNING By Muhammad Ulumuddin Pragmatic is the study of the relation between language and context that are basic to an account of language understanding. the study about the relationship between context and meaning is the main purpose of Pragmatics. Politeness is one of pragmatics studies. Politeness is a “polite social behavior ”within a certain culture. It is the form people save other people’s face and feeling in communication. The research methodology of this research was descriptive qualitative. In this research, the data were obtained from Webinar Video Parent�Family Distance Learning Webinar 8-31.. In collecting the data, the researcher used documentation. The source of analyzing the data in this study through documentation was taken from Webinar Video Parent-Family Distance Learning Webinar 8-31. To made the classification of data analysis, the Researcher developed a coding system to each datum. in this study the researcher is the main instrument. The Researcher used the type of triangulation data to check the validation of the data. From The result, it can be concluded that there are the occurrences of positive politeness strategies and negative politeness strategies with the way those strategies are realized by the speakers in Webinar Video Parent-Family Distance Learning Webinar 8-31. There are 79 occurrences of politeness. Rather than negative politeness strategies, positive politeness strategy has the most occurrences. It shows that the speakers prefer employing positive politeness strategy to other strategies in their utterances. As it is seen, positive politeness is applied in as many as 55 times by the speaker. It is followed by negative politeness strategy which is applied in as many as 24 times. Keywords: Pragmatic, Positive politeness, Negative politeness.
